For a long time mechanical keys were the only way to secure vehicles. However, they're quickly becoming a thing of the past as automakers integrate microchips into their locks and ignition systems. Transponder keys make up the majority of the microchip-equipped modern keys. These keys are equipped with microchips within them which transmit an individual digital signature when inserted into the keyhole or turned on in the ignition. When local key cutting matching digital signature is received the immobilizer will be disarmed and allow the vehicle to begin. Some come with scanners to detect pins and key codes. What is a key-cutting machine? Key cutting machines are pieces of equipment that helps you create new keys or duplicates of existing ones. They come in many different styles however they all function in the same manner. They trace the profile of the key blank on the blank key and cut the profile with the help of a knife. This creates a flawless duplicate key that is ready to use in your locks. You will need to select the right machine according to the type of key that you are cutting. Some keys are tubular while others are cylindrical and feature long blades and bows. Some require the use of a pocket (mortice) to be cut. You'll need a key cutter that can cut different shapes of keys. When choosing a key-cutting device It is crucial to take note of the capacity of the machine to cut several keys simultaneously. This is particularly beneficial when your company requires you to cut many identical key sets. It can save both time and money. Some of the more sophisticated machines can be programmed to repeat the cutting process over and over making it simpler and quicker to cut keys. Manually-operated key-cutting machines require you to manually move the key blank as well as the original key along the tracer wheel and cutter wheel. This can be difficult for those working with larger keys or an unfamiliar machine. Semi-Automatic Machines resemble Manual key-cutting machines but there are some differences. The main difference is the carriage (the part which holds keys) that is spring-loaded and presses tightly against the key tracer wheel as well as the cutter wheel. This means that you don't need to be as precise when placing the key and you can let the machine cut the key for you. The top semi-automatic machines are the Silca Futura Auto, Futura Pro and the Laser Key Products 3D Extreme. Automated machines are among the most modern and advanced kind of key-cutting machines available on the market. Computer-driven, you will spend 99% of your time inside the software telling it what to cut. These machines are extremely precise and allow you to go about your business while they cut the key.
